高速动车组停放缸弹簧力值衰减原因分析及试验优化

摘  要:高速动车组检修时发现制动缸的停放制动力输出不足,对停放制动夹钳单元检修时发现,停放弹簧力值的衰减是停放制动缸输出力不足的主要原因。研究发现,停放弹簧力值衰减的主要原因是弹簧应力松弛,而导致弹簧应力松弛的主要因素是弹簧长期处于高应力区工作。为优化弹簧应力松弛表现,提出通过更换材料和工艺的方法降低弹簧高应力区表现。最后,通过应力松弛对比试验对优化方案进行验证,得到改善停放弹簧力值衰减的方法,有效地降低了停放制动夹钳单元的维护成本。During the maintenance of high-speed trains,it is found that the parking brake force output of the brake cylinder is insufficient.During the maintenance of the parking brake caliper unit,it is found that parking spring force attenuation is the main reason for the insufficient output force of the parking brake cylinder.However,the reason for the force attenuation of the parking spring is the spring stress relaxation,and the main factor leading to the spring stress relaxation is that the spring works in the high stress area for a long time.In order to optimize the stress relaxation performance of spring,the method of changing materials and processes was proposed to reduce the performance of high stress area of spring.Finally,through the stress relaxation comparison test,the optimization scheme is verified,and the method to improve the force attenuation of the parking spring is obtained,which effectively reduces the maintenance cost of the parking brake caliper unit.

关 键 词:弹簧 力值衰减 应力松弛 停放制动单元
